Menopause can bring about a range of physical and emotional changes, with fatigue being a common symptom. This fatigue during menopause stems from fluctuations in hormone levels, particularly estrogen. Menopause is a natural biological transition that marks the end of a woman's reproductive years. It typically occurs between the ages of 45 and 55, though it can happen earlier or later for some women.
